North Dakota Winter Show

The North Dakota Winter Show is an agriculture and livestock show held in Valley City, North Dakota the first full week of every March. The Winter Show started in 1937 and has an annual attendance of around 70,000 people.

Events

  • Concerts
  • Livestock shows
  • PRCA rodeo
  • State crop show
  • 4-H and FFA livestock judging
  • 4-H and FFA crop judging
  • Special events
  • Livestock sales
